Sep 20, 2017 the sixteen personality factor questionnaire 16pf, originally developed by cattell and mead, is a 185item measure of normal personality which is currently in its fifth edition. The predictive value of the cattell 16 factor personality test on the occurrence of automobile accidents among conscripts during their 11month military service in a transportation section of finnish defense forces was examined.
